Assembler HD44780 Ansteuern

A1140NE

Neues Mitglied
02. Dez. 2012
7
0
0
32
Sprachen
Hallo, ich kam endlich dazu mit Microcontrollern weiterzu machen und habe mir bei ebay ein 2x16 LCD (HD44780 1602) gekauft.
Nun habe ich alles wie hier http://www.mikrocontroller.net/articles/AVR-Tutorial:_LCD beschrieben verkabelt und auch die dortige Routinen benutzt und das erste beispiel bei Anwendungen auf den Controller(Atmega16) geflasht. Leider Tat sich garnichts. Es ist immernoch nur der Balken zu sehen.
Nun ist mir aber was komisches aufgefallen:
Ich habe das STK500 von Atmel
Beim Breadboard sind ist an der + "linie" VTG angestöpselt und an der - "linie" GND. So da PIN 16 und 15 Kathode bzw Anode des Backlight sind und diese Direkt mit VTG und GND verbunden sind, sollte das Backlight ausgehen, sobald ich VTG oder GND ausstöpsele. Jedoch bleibt das Backlight noch an und nur der Balken ist nur noch ganz schwach zu sehen.

Wie bekomme ich die Anzeige zum Laufen?
 
Hallo,
du kannst ja mal versuchen DB0 bis DB3 an GND anzuschließen und nicht offen zu lassen wie es dort beschrieben ist.
Das soll bei manchen LCDs Probleme geben.

Wenn du die Balken schon auf dem LCD siehst und die anderen Datenbits richtig angeschlossen sind, würde ich eher auf ein Software Problem tippen.
 
Ich habs Geschafft. Anscheinend hat das Breadboard schaden genommen, als ich die PINS an das LCD gelötet hab, währed es im Breadboard war... Hinzu kommt noch, dass ich vergessen hatte RW auf GND zu schalten :D
 
Hi,

Anscheinend hat das Breadboard schaden genommen, als ich die PINS an das LCD gelötet hab, währed es im Breadboard war...
da würde ich mal sagen ... löten lernen :p

Ich mach das immer so da die Pins dadurch schön ausgerichtet werden. Man darf natürlich nicht minutenlang rumbraten. Das nimmt einem nicht nur das Breadboard übel :rolleyes:
Lötkolben auf 350°C und dann schnell und mit etwas Zugabe von Lötzinn zusammenlöten. Löte einfach mal zwei Drähte zusammen die du zwischen den Fingern hälst. Wenn du dir die Finger verbrennst, dann dauert der Lötvorgang zu lange :sarcastic:

Gruß
Dino
 
Hi,


da würde ich mal sagen ... löten lernen :p

Ich mach das immer so da die Pins dadurch schön ausgerichtet werden. Man darf natürlich nicht minutenlang rumbraten. Das nimmt einem nicht nur das Breadboard übel :rolleyes:
Lötkolben auf 350°C und dann schnell und mit etwas Zugabe von Lötzinn zusammenlöten. Löte einfach mal zwei Drähte zusammen die du zwischen den Fingern hälst. Wenn du dir die Finger verbrennst, dann dauert der Lötvorgang zu lange :sarcastic:

Gruß
Dino

Ich hatte damals in der 8. Klasse im Technik-Unterricht gelernt die Lötstelle schön vorzuwärmen, weil das besser halten soll, aber damals haben wir auf Holzplatten mit reißzwecken gelötet... :D Das Breadboard ist wohl hin, zumindest die Zeilen und Nachbarzeilen die eingesteckt waren beim Löten. Ich habs aber in Kauf genommen, damit die Pins schön gerade sind :D
 
Hallo,

Ich hatte damals in der 8. Klasse im Technik-Unterricht gelernt die Lötstelle schön vorzuwärmen, weil das besser halten soll, aber damals haben wir auf Holzplatten mit reißzwecken gelötet... :D
jaja ... die Schulzeit :rolleyes: Drähte auf Reißzwecken und ne Lampe dran oder nen Motor ;) Ist doch ein wenig was anderes als wenn man nen IC, Transistor, ... lötet. Kurz und schmerzlos und dann muß gut sein.

Gruß
Dino
 

Über uns

  • Makerconnect ist ein Forum, welches wir ausschließlich für einen Gedankenaustausch und als Diskussionsplattform für Interessierte bereitstellen, welche sich privat, durch das Studium oder beruflich mit Mikrocontroller- und Kleinstrechnersystemen beschäftigen wollen oder müssen ;-)
  • Dirk
  • Du bist noch kein Mitglied in unserer freundlichen Community? Werde Teil von uns und registriere dich in unserem Forum.
  •  Registriere dich

User Menu

 Kaffeezeit

  • Wir arbeiten hart daran sicherzustellen, dass unser Forum permanent online und schnell erreichbar ist, unsere Forensoftware auf dem aktuellsten Stand ist und der Server regelmäßig gewartet wird. Auch die Themen Datensicherheit und Datenschutz sind uns wichtig und hier sind wir auch ständig aktiv. Alles in allem, sorgen wir uns darum, dass alles Drumherum stimmt :-)

    Dir gefällt das Forum und unsere Arbeit und du möchtest uns unterstützen? Unterstütze uns durch deine Premium-Mitgliedschaft!
    Wir freuen uns auch über eine Spende für unsere Kaffeekasse :-)
    Vielen Dank! :ciao:


     Spende uns! (Paypal)